my windows xp does not start and it only shows the arrow and a black screen in the Middle, what can I do to solve this problem.
Try to restart your machine and pressing F8 before the spash screen Windows appears. Choose the option "last last known good configuration".
If this fails, you can try to repair your installation of starting for the original CD-ROM for Windows XP installation and choosing the option 'Fix' when prompted.

I solved the problem. Good thing I didn't order the restore disks, because that would not have solved the problem.
I decided to post it because I don't know there will be others who have HP Pavilion Elite m9754sc and will have to face this problem of a black screen after the restoration.
The fact is that the restore worked perfectly, but in this display card driver is buggy and it causes the screen to go black.
I thought that what I installed fresh Vista which worked until I installed the driver from the recovery partition display. I tried VGA, outputs HDMI and DVI on the factory installed GeForce GT220 and none worked.
A defective display driver should normally be no problem we could go in safe mode and fix it to the it. But as with the recovery goes to pre install state (ask what language to use etc.), safe mode does not work.
So the solution is to unlock the display of the motherboard connectors and remove the factory installed GeForce GT220. Once the recovery and installation of Windows is finished using the graphics card integrated motherboards, you can reconnect the GeForce GT220 and get a updated driver with safe mode.
